On transports in general there should be something of use in:
Condon 'Living Conditions on Board Troopships during the War against Revolutionary France, 1793-1815' Journal of the Society for Army Historical Research vol XLIX Spring 1979 no. 197 p 14-19
And there is a little bit about horses in
An Eloquent Soldier. The Peninsular War Journals of Lieutenant Charles Crowe of the Inniskillings, 1812-1814 edited by Gareth Glover p 16
I imagine some cavalry officers would mention how their horses fared on the voyage out, but I don't have a note of any in particular.
